    Re: When did they introduce 3rd row seats?

    > What model year was the first to have optional 3rd row seats?

    The 2002 four-door. Mine has them. They're great!
     

    Hmmm...I don't know. I had a 1999 XLT and now a 2002 Eddie Bauer, and,
    except for the signal lever in the '99, I've never had a problem with either
    one. 

    Yes. My 2002 Eddie Bauer has dual-zone, driver/passenger climate controls.
    They're standard with the EB and the Limited. It also has the optional
    auxiliary (second and third row) climate controls.
